1989 Subaru Legacy coolant capacity

The 1989 Subaru Legacy holds about 6.2 to 6.8 quarts of coolant, depending on the engine - the full cooling-system capacity when cold.

Key takeaways

  • The 1989 Subaru Legacy holds about 6.2 to 6.8 quarts of coolant total, depending on engine.
  • This is the full cooling-system fill with the engine cold.
  • Refill to the marked level, and use the coolant type your owner's manual specifies.
